SACRAMENTO, Calif. (AP) - Authorities say a lion has killed someone at a private animal sanctuary in Central California.

Cal Fire spokesman Ryan Michaels told The Associated Press that a person who got into a cage with the lion was attacked and fatally injured at the Cat Haven sanctuary in Dunlap, Calif., about 45 miles east of Fresno in the Sierra Nevada foothills.

Michaels says he thinks the lion was put down because law enforcement officers at the scene fired shots, and the Fresno County sheriff's office said on the radio that the animal had been secured.
